Answer:

It shows a contradiction because (a − 4b) / b is a rational number and √5 is an irrational number.

Explanation:

A rational number can be written as a ratio of two integers.

An irrational number cannot.

(a − 4b) / b is a rational number.

√5 is an irrational number.
